Bakati Population - Gondiya, Maharashtra
Bakati is a medium size village located in Arjuni Morgaon Taluka of Gondiya district, Maharashtra with total 489 families residing. The Bakati village has population of 1910 of which 957 are males while 953 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bakati village population of children with age 0-6 is 213 which makes up 11.15 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bakati village is 996 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Bakati as per census is 1088, higher than Maharashtra average of 894.
Bakati village has higher liter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Bakati village was 82.73 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Bakati Male literacy stands at 92.87 % while female literacy rate was 72.45 %.

Bakati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 489 | - | - |
| Population | 1,910 | 957 | 953 |
| Child (0-6) | 213 | 102 | 111 |
| Schedule Caste | 780 | 403 | 377 |
| Schedule Tribe | 238 | 110 | 128 |
| Literacy | 82.73 % | 92.87 % | 72.45 % |
| Total Workers | 1,061 | 565 | 496 |
| Main Worker | 679 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 382 | 188 | 194 |
